The lengths of 45 French fries, randomly selected from a huge shipment, were measured and a mean length of 8.4 cm with standard deviation of 3.1 cm was found.
a. Construct a 95% confidence interval for the population mean length of a French fry.
b. Compute the number of French fries that would have to be sampled and measured to be 98% sure of being within 0.4 cm of the true mean.
